It In underHtood that the Duke of
Dcvonnhlre -will hooh retire bh (Jovor-nor-Gtneral
of Canada unit that tho
Duke of Atblone, brother ot Queen
Mary, will be offered this pout. The
Duke of Athlone, who Ik forty-five
years old, probably would have hiic
cocded the Duke of Connuught had It
not been for his duties with the Drit
lh army. He 1h the Hon of the Duke
of Tock..Tho DucbfbH of Athlone wuh
I'rlnccsB Alice, duughter of the lute
Duke of Albany,
